## The Design of a Void Suit: Protection and Innovation
The Void Suit is an engineering marvel. At first glance, it may look like an intimidating, bulky ensemble, but it’s carefully constructed to balance protection, mobility, and comfort. The key to its design lies in multiple layers of advanced materials, each serving a specific function.
1. **Pressure Layers**
One of the Void Suit’s most important functions is maintaining pressure to keep the astronaut’s body stable in the vacuum of space. The pressure layers are built with specialized fabrics that expand to form a snug, life-sustaining environment, keeping blood circulation and bodily functions in check. This pressure also prevents bodily fluids from boiling due to the lack of external pressure, a phenomenon known as ebullism.
2. **Thermal Insulation**
In space, temperatures fluctuate drastically. Without a proper thermal layer, an astronaut would be subjected to either extreme freezing or burning conditions. The Void Suit’s thermal insulation utilizes cutting-edge materials like aerogels and reflective coatings, ensuring that the astronaut’s temperature remains stable, no matter if they’re facing the blistering heat of the Sun or the deep freeze of shadowed space.
3. **Radiation Shielding**
Space is filled with dangerous radiation from the Sun and cosmic rays. While Earth’s atmosphere protects us from these harmful rays, astronauts don’t have that luxury. The Void Suit integrates radiation-shielding materials to reduce exposure, protecting the astronaut from cancerous risks and long-term health effects.
4. **Micrometeoroid Protection**
A subtle but deadly hazard in space is micrometeoroids—small, high-speed particles that can puncture a suit and cause catastrophic damage. Void Suits come equipped with multi-layered impact-resistant fabrics that prevent these high-speed particles from breaching the suit, ensuring the astronaut’s safety during spacewalks and in the dark, uncertain stretches of outer space.
## Key Features of the Void Suit
1. **Helmet with Advanced Visor**
The helmet of a Void Suit is equipped with an advanced visor system, providing astronauts with a clear, unobstructed view of their surroundings. The visor incorporates HUD (Heads-Up Display) technology, showing vital statistics, mission data, and navigation systems in real-time.
2. **Integrated Life Support Systems**
The Void Suit is not only about protection; it also supports the astronaut’s biological needs. Its integrated life support systems regulate the suit’s oxygen levels, carbon dioxide removal, and even manage waste disposal. Astronauts can survive for extended periods in space without having to return to their spacecraft, thanks to this self-sufficient system.
3. **Enhanced Mobility and Flexibility**

While the Void Suit is engineered for protection, it doesn’t compromise on the astronaut’s ability to move. Advanced joint technology, flexible materials, and ergonomic design ensure that astronauts can perform critical tasks, from repairing spacecraft to conducting scientific research, with ease.
